Output e2443425b33a41a031baa8205958c20c6b3ae99825a8c5ab53026448027fd2ff:0

value
24669
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5455c95c82d83abf5e680c6d3ba7f6fd5331353 OP_EQUALVERIFY OP_CHECKSIG
address
1LSg2CAheUUH2unBwYQmP6e6GyfqjkEn6r
transaction
e2443425b33a41a031baa8205958c20c6b3ae99825a8c5ab53026448027fd2ff
spent
true